Implement three deletion modes for recurring events:
- single: exclude specific occurrence via EXDATE mechanism
- future: set RRULE UNTIL to stop future occurrences
- all: delete entire event series
Changes include:
- Add exceptionDates field to CalendarEvent model
- Add RecurringDeleteMode type and DeleteRecurringEventDTO
- EventService.deleteRecurring() with mode-based logic using rrule library
- EventController DELETE endpoint accepts mode/occurrenceDate query params
- recurrenceExpander filters out exception dates during expansion
- AI tools support deleteMode and occurrenceDate for proposed deletions
- ChatService.confirmEvent() handles recurring delete modes
- New DeleteEventModal component for unified delete confirmation UI
- Calendar screen integrates modal for both recurring and non-recurring events
